Peirce College is a private institution in Philadelphia with particular strength in business and health sciences.

A small campus of 789 undergraduates with a 11:1 student-faculty ratio. The urban location puts students at the center of city life.

5% of students graduate within four years, and graduates earn a median of $50,660 a decade after enrollment. Net price after aid averages $12,905.
